The yin er cheongsam, often referred to as the traditional Chinese旗袍, is a full-length garment that typically features a close-fitting bodice and a gracefully flowing skirt. It is cut and styled to accentuate the wearer's figure, while also embodying the traditional values of modesty and elegance. The design elements of the yin er cheongsam are intricate and diverse, ranging from floral patterns, animal motifs, to traditional Chinese knots and symbols.

The history of the yin er cheongsam is closely linked to the history of Chinese fashion. It originated in the late 19th century as a traditional women's garment, evolving over time to adapt to changing fashion trends and social norms. The yin er cheongsam, however, has always maintained its unique characteristics, blending traditional elements with modern designs to create a timeless piece of clothing.

The craftsmanship involved in making a yin er cheongsam is remarkable. The fabric is typically made from silk or synthetic materials, which are then cut and sewn together with precision. The seams are carefully stitched, and the edges are trimmed with intricate patterns and designs. The final product is a seamless blend of beauty and functionality, designed to compliment the wearer's figure and accentuate her movements.
